Barrick and Newmont Agree to Nevada JV! Hell Has Frozen Over and The Leafs Are Going to Win the Stanley Cup!
After decades of vying for top gold producer status, and conducting M&A almost out of spite, the two rivals have finally decided to tie up what should have been done decades ago. A bonus for Goldcorp shareholders currently under a bid by Newmont due to synergies going forward.

Newmont-Goldcorp: Despite Eyeing Eachother Up For Years, Courtship (Due Diligence), Engagement (Approving Deal) and Marriage (Shareholder Vote) All Happened Rapidly
All the deal history can be read in the Management Information Circular released March 7th, 2019. However, page 62 outlines the rapidity of due diligence, magnified by the time it happened around Christmas/New Year's.
What was the rush? Newmont CEO Goldberg's upcoming retirement? Knowledge of an imminent Barrick bid? Something yet to be released by Goldcorp?
We are likely to find out after April 4th - shareholder vote day (writedowns have already been made by Goldcorp).
